問題タブ [vimdiff]
For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.
vim - Vim で開いているすべてのファイルにオプションを適用する
2 つのファイルに対して vimdiff を実行します。:set wrap
2 つのファイルをラップする場合は、各ファイルに個別に 2 回適用する必要があります。
set wrap
同じコマンドを 2 回実行せずに両方に同時に適用する方法はありますか?
git - git mergetool が vimdiff で 4 つのウィンドウを開くのはなぜですか? (私は3を期待しています)
対立に遭遇したとき、git-mergetool
それを解決するために使用しようとしました。私が入力した:
vimdiff
3wayではなく4wayで開きました。vimdiff の分割ウィンドウは次のようになります。
彼らは何ですか?ターゲット ファイル、マージ ファイル、作業ファイルの 3 方向の diff が必要です。git または vimdiff をどのように構成すればよいですか?
vim - vimdiff 出力を保存しますか?
過去にこれを何度もグーグルで検索しましたが、答えが見つかりませんでした。vimdiff の出力を保存する方法はありますか (できれば色、ハイライトなどを維持しながら)? この 1 つの出力ファイルを他の人に送信して、「このファイルを開いてください。相違点を並べて強調表示します」と伝えたいと思います。
この目的で vimdiff に代わるより良い方法がある場合は、提案を受け付けています。Windows と Linux の両方のプラットフォームで動作するものが理想的です。
vim - 保留中のviウィンドウを閉じて開く
:qall によって vim で開いているすべてのバッファを閉じることができることを知っています。
保留中の開始バッファへのイベントを閉じたい。
P4 サンドボックスで変更を確認しているときに問題が発生しました。複数のファイルに変更があり、「P4 diff」でコードを確認して、P4DIFF を vimdiff に設定しようとした場合。
変更されたすべてのファイルの vimdiff を 1 つずつ開きます。10 個のファイルが開いていて、2 個のファイルを確認した後、残りの 8 個のファイルの diff を閉じたいとします。どうやってやるの?
ありがとう、
vim - vimdiff で違いを OK としてマークする
エラーをチェックする必要があるいくつかの大きなjsonファイルがあり、違いをOKとしてマークし、それを差分セッション全体に適用して、ファイル内でそれをさらに削除できるかどうか疑問に思っていました。
例
ここでは、この変更を「OK」差分としてマークできるようにしたいと考えています (つまり、名前と明らかな性別の変更を期待しています)。
vim - vimの2つの名前付きファイル間で差分を取る
私のプロジェクト回帰設定では、出力ファイルには次のようなステートメントがあります
次に、foo.txtとbar.txtの間でvimdiffを使用する必要があります。vimでのみ開いた出力ファイルからそれを行うことはできますか?
現在、vimで出力ファイルを最初に開く必要があります。次に、見つかった差分を指定する行を選択する必要があります。シェルに戻った後。次に、このファイルのvimdiffを取得します。
git - git、vimdiff、dirdiff
Git でバージョン管理された Vim 内の複数のファイルを比較するために、vimdiff+ dirdiff.vimを使用しようとしています。
Mercurial の場合、mercurial extdiff拡張で可能です。
Vim を Git diff と統合するために Web で見つけた唯一の方法は、この投稿で説明されているように、単一のファイルで vimdiff を使用することです。
vimdiff + dirdiff + gitの使い方を知っている人はいますか?
vim - vimdiff 出力で特定の単語を含む行を無視する
vimdiff を取得する 2 つの大きなファイルがあります。vimdiff の出力で、diff を示す行を無視したいのですが、特定の単語があります。
たとえば、私の場合WARNING:
、ファイル内のプレフィックスを持つすべての行の diff を無視したいと考えています。
ありがとう、
vim - VIMコマンドモードでvimdiffを使用するには?
:vimdiff file1 file2
これらのファイルを VIM コマンド モードで比較したいのですが、エラー メッセージが表示されますE492: Not an editor command: vimdiff
。私は何かを忘れていますか?それを解決する方法は?
Vim のマニュアルによると、vimdiff コマンドが利用できるはずです。
tabs - vimdiffのタブ間の行をコピーして貼り付けます
2 つのファイルの違いを確認するために vimdiff を使用しています。左のタブ (最初のファイル) から行をコピーして、2 番目のタブ (2 番目のファイル) に貼り付けることができるかどうか疑問に思っています。実際には、2 番目のタブにアクセスすることさえできないようです。
ありがとうございました!